Critical thinking is the ability to analyze information objectively and make informed judgments. It involves asking questions, evaluating evidence, and considering different perspectives before coming to a conclusion. In the context of misinformation, critical thinking is a powerful tool that can help individuals navigate the flood of false information that bombards them on a daily basis. When it comes to Bolivian culture, critical thinking skills can play a crucial role in preserving and promoting the rich traditions of the country. With the rise of social media and fake news, it has become increasingly important for Bolivians to critically evaluate the information they come across, especially when it pertains to their cultural heritage. For example, if someone comes across a viral video claiming to showcase a traditional Bolivian dance but has doubts about its authenticity, they can use their critical thinking skills to research the origins of the dance, consult experts in Bolivian culture, and cross-reference information from reliable sources. By approaching the information with a critical eye, individuals can protect the integrity of Bolivian cultural practices and prevent the spread of misinformation. Furthermore, critical thinking skills can empower individuals to be more discerning consumers of information, not only in the realm of Bolivian culture but in all areas of life. By honing their ability to think critically, individuals can avoid falling prey to misinformation, fake news, and propaganda, ultimately becoming more engaged and informed members of society. In conclusion, in order to safeguard Bolivian culture and combat misinformation, it is essential for individuals to cultivate strong critical thinking skills. By approaching information with a critical eye, asking important questions, and evaluating evidence carefully, individuals can help preserve the rich cultural heritage of Bolivia and contribute to a more informed and enlightened society.
